School leaders must meet two goals to make schools more effective: provide a defensible set of directions and influence people to move in those directions. Recent evidence challenges the conventional wisdom of leadership ...In addition, an effective vision about a desired change grows from the interactions of the school actors and is stimulated and orchestrated by the school leadership. An imposition from above as well as a lack of leadership vision in fragmented school cultures cannot determine any transformation, nor its subsequent stability or growth, given ...
